Output 16440fa7bf3eee4e593353d513ede66be2685b05fbd74836c7ab5900b279c876:0

value
2994809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3de752d4af4e7a1b3d96e6e811046ac34ef2e8d4 OP_EQUAL
address
37LLFtTQvwcqwEBrtU9RH6Ws4mbePufGUv
transaction
16440fa7bf3eee4e593353d513ede66be2685b05fbd74836c7ab5900b279c876
spent
true